He did mention the 19 code in his book Al Quran, the Ultimate Miracle. He does have traditional views on certain issues(Hijab) , yet he had some very non-traditional views on others ( especially regarding Jesus p.b.u.h. and the crucifixion) there was a rumor that he was Qadiani but he denied this.

As far as I know, Ahmad Deedat was a Sunni Moslem, and he accepted Rashad Khalifa's code 19 concept as proof of the preservation and divinity of the Qur'aan. He never became a member of the International Submitters group, and he never accepted Rashad Khalifa as a divinely-sent messenger...
